About this map

Holden Mine and the nearby settlement of Holden stand as the primary industrial hub in this 1944 aerial survey of the North Cascades. Located along Railroad Creek, the mining operation is surrounded by the glaciated terrain of the Chelan National Forest and Wenatchee National Forest. The landscape is defined by massive peaks and ice fields, including Bonanza Peak and the Lyman Glacier, which feed the drainages of the Chiwawa River and Entiat River.
